- LANSING — A package of road funding bills Gov. Rick Snyder signed into law this week will have a positive effect on more than $1 billion in state transportation bonds, according to credit ratings agency Moody’s Investors Service. Moody’s called the road legislation “credit positive,” meaning the action is a positive development for the Michigan Department of Transportation’s comprehensive transportation and state trunkline bond funds.
